Output 24b598510d9c2b0363e85bdb7649d1742f83d8d8cf747ed8ebaef0e034cf83a5:3

value
498867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bc75d0f9ca0a4a56b5e5b59c1d2d8c663f89037 OP_EQUAL
address
3Jou7SFgrKQRcEKAWzt4DE3iucKroau7Dw
transaction
24b598510d9c2b0363e85bdb7649d1742f83d8d8cf747ed8ebaef0e034cf83a5
spent
true